Lawrence, KS – The Hastings College women's bowling team was in action this past weekend finishing eighth in NAIA Tournament No. 1 and then finished 13th in NAIA Tournament No. 2.
The Lady Broncos finished tournament one with a total pin count of 6551 while Ottawa won with a total of 7208.
Marissa Ruiz led the way on day one with a total pin count of 1025 for an average of 205 which was good enough for a fifth place finish that earned her All-Tournament team honors. Her best game was in game two with a 233. The next top finisher was KInzi Temple as she finished 28th with a total pin count of 911 for an average of 182.2. Her best game was in game three with a 192.
On day two the Lady Broncos finished with a total pin count of 5464 while Ottawa won with a total pin count of 6429.
Leading the way on day two was Ruiz as she finished 28th with a total pin count of 1176 for an average of 168. Her best game was in game five with a 193.
